India-Pakistan strikes: 5 essential reads on decades of rivalry and tensions over Kashmir

  • India conducted targeted strikes in Pakistan following a Kashmir attack that resulted in civilian casualties, as reported by the Indian government.
  • Pakistan condemned the strikes, labeling them an 'act of war,' and reported 26 civilian deaths and 46 injuries from the attack.
  • India reported seven civilian deaths and 35 injuries due to cross-border shelling by Pakistani troops in Kashmir.
  • In response to the volatile security situation between the two countries, a travel advisory was issued by Pakistan's ministry.
